recently the boiler has started the noise as in the videos. No idea where to start from. The boiler is used rarely, but for a while the top up valves where open which meant the pressure was always high when the boiler was on, this was fixed but the has started a while after the valve was turned off. The boiler has not been serviced for 2 years (new house owner and recently found out they need servicing) Any advise what this could be how much will it cost to be fixed? Thanks

Sounds like pump issue / circulation time to call a gas safe engy out
 
Cheers for the comments guys. Could result in the pump need replacing? Also will Vaillant cover parts replacement if the boiler is still under warranty? (Installed 2014). Thanks
 
Has it been serviced yearly as warranty is void if not ?
 
I very much doubt it but if it's been serviced every year since it had been installed and you have the bench mark completed and service records then it's worth a call I suppose, but I would prepare yourself for a paid engineers visit. Regards kop
 
Just an update on this. I got the boiler serviced and the engineer was surprised of how new it looks from inside. However, he didn’t detect any faults with the boiler, the only problem thought there is, was the prv (?) cause as he demounted the computer, the boiler releases water from the 15mm copper pipe that runs to outside and the fact the red cap of the valve was able to twist/loose. After he finished the boiler it still made the same noise left and he came back again another day, had a good look, called Vaillant but they were useless.

As he put the front panel on again and turned the boiler on, the noise came on, he played with panel a a bit and the noise changed or stopped in some cases. So he and I believe is the front panel causing the noises, is this possible?
